1. Purpose

The calibration of the Refrigerator Temp Probe (2-8°C) is performed to ensure accurate temperature readings within the specified range, thereby controlling risks associated with product integrity, patient safety, and batch quality. Accurate temperature monitoring is critical for maintaining Good Distribution Practice (GDP) storage conditions, ensuring that products remain within acceptable limits to prevent degradation and ensure compliance with regulatory standards.

3. Definitions

  • Calibration: The process of comparing a measurement device to a known standard to determine its accuracy.
  • Verification: The process of confirming that a measurement device operates within specified limits.
  • Adjustment: The act of modifying a measurement device to bring it within specified limits.
  • As Found: The condition of the equipment prior to any adjustments being made.
  • As Left: The condition of the equipment after adjustments have been made.
  • OOT (Out of Tolerance): A condition where the measurement exceeds the defined acceptance criteria.
  • Drift: The gradual change in a measurement device’s output over time.
  • Traceability: The ability to verify the history, location, or application of an item by means of documented recorded identification.
  • Measurement Uncertainty: A parameter that characterizes the range of values within which the true value is estimated to lie.
  • Intermediate Check: A verification process performed between calibrations to ensure continued accuracy.

8. Calibration Strategy

Calibration will follow the As Found and As Left logic:

  • Minimum number of points: At least 5 points including endpoints (2°C, 8°C) and midpoints (5°C, 3°C, 7°C).
  • Replicate readings: Perform 3 repeats at each point as a best practice.

9. Step-by-Step Procedure

  1. Preparation: Gather all necessary tools and reference standards.
  2. Stabilization: Allow the temperature probe to stabilize at the operating environment.
  3. As Found checks and data capture: Record initial temperature readings at defined points.
  4. Adjustment rules: If OOT is detected, follow adjustment procedures if allowed; otherwise, escalate to QA.
  5. As Left verification: After adjustments, recheck and record temperature readings.
  6. Labeling + documentation completion: Ensure all records are filled out contemporaneously (ALCOA+).

10. Acceptance Criteria & Calculations

Acceptance criteria: ±0.5°C from the target range.

Error calculation formula: Error = Observed Value – True Value.

Pass/Fail Logic: If the absolute value of Error is less than or equal to 0.5°C, then Pass; otherwise, Fail.

11. Handling OOT / Failures

  • Immediate containment: Tag equipment and stop use until resolved.
  • Notification & deviation initiation: Notify QA and initiate deviation process.
  • Impact assessment trigger: Define impact window and review of affected results/batches.
  • Recalibration after repair/adjustment: Ensure recalibration is performed post-adjustment.

Stepwise Instructions

  1. Preparation: Ensure the temperature probe is clean and calibrated within the last 180 days.
  2. Stabilization: Allow the probe to stabilize in the cold storage environment for at least 30 minutes before taking readings.
  3. Performing Readings: Take three replicate readings at each test point to ensure accuracy.
  4. Calculating Error: Calculate the error by subtracting the reference value from the observed value.
  5. Evaluation: Compare the error against the acceptance criteria of ±0.5°C.
  6. Documentation: Record all observed values, errors, and pass/fail results in the results table.
